38 Protection from liability

If:

(a)

the Inspector, or a person assisting another person in the exercise of powers or performance of functions under this Act (an assistant), requests a person to give the Inspector or the assistant information or produce to the Inspector or the assistant a document under this Division and the person does so in the honest and reasonable belief that the request is permitted under this Division; or

(b)

the Inspector or an assistant requests a government agency to give the Inspector or the assistant information or produce to the Inspector or the assistant a document under this Division, and a person does so on behalf of the agency in the honest and reasonable belief that the request is permitted under this Division;

the person is not liable:

(c)

to any proceedings for contravening any other law because of that conduct; or

(d)

to civil proceedings for loss, damage or injury of any kind suffered by another person because of that conduct; or

(e)

to disciplinary action, or to a disciplinary sanction, of any kind because of that conduct.
